3270.70(a) · The indoor temperature shall be at least 65° F.
The heat was not operational in the preschool room throughout the week of December 2, 2024. At the time of inspection on Friday, December 6th, 2024, the thermostat in the room read at 59° F. The temperature reportedly had dropped into the low 50s at the beginning and/or end of some days throughout the week. While the group was using alternative spaces throughout the day, children were observed eating lunch in the room and the staff were getting the group ready for naptime in the room.

3270.119 · Infants shall be placed in the sleeping position recommended by the American Academy of Pediatrics unless there is a medical reason an infant should not sleep in this position. The medical reason shall be documented in a statement signed by a physician, physician's assistant or CRNP and placed in the child's record at the facility.
Facility person 1 was observed placing an infant on their stomach to sleep.

3270.95(a)/3270.95(b) · Fire detection devices or systems must be in compliance with standards established under section 1016(c) of the act (62 P.S. § 1016(c)). The Director or designated staff person who is responsible for compliance with this chapter shall ensure the requirements under subsection (a) are met. To verify operability, a child care center shall manually test all fire detection devices or systems at least once every thirty days and shall maintain a written record of the testing with the facility's fire drill logs.
Manual tests of the fire detection system were completed on 7/5/24 and more than 30 days later on 8/9/24.
